Unhappy Webmin shows Bind down, but its running

I am using webmin 9.2.1 and BIND 8.

Bind is running. I even restarted it (and webmin) just to be sure.

However, webmin refuses to see BIND as running. It keeps showing it is down. So when I make changes to my DNS records, I can't apply them. It gives me a start button instead of apply. I click it and it says its already running so I can't start it.

Any ideas on how to get webmin to see that BIND is, in fact, running?

Perhaps the PID file location is incorrectly in the BIND module config ?

You may need to edit the location of BIND in the webmin module configuration to match your local machine. I had this problem with several apps since the latest supported version of OpenBSD is 3.2 and I am on 3.3. ALthough I just found the port in the OBSD ports tree and I installed from source...so there may be a difference. there.
